The Indian Film Festival of Melbourne was founded in 2012. It is a State Government of Victoria funded annual festival based in Melbourne. It is presented by Film Victoria, and the provider is chosen through a tender process. The current tender provider is Mind Blowing Films, run by Mitu Bhowmick Lange. The festival has currently been provided with State Government funding till 2018. Read More
